If you experience any problems, please call the Helpline on Freephone 0800 218 2182* or email bt. helpdesk@vtecheurope. com 23 Handset settings Handset ringer melody There are 5 different ringer melodies to choose from for both internal and external calls. until the display shows hS SeTTingS and until ringer is displayed and press . 4. Press or to select either inT ring or eXT ring for internal or external call ringer melody and press . The current ringtone is played, use or to listen to the alternatives and press to confirm your choice. Press and hold to return to standby. Handset ringer volume There are 5 volume levels and Ringer Off to choose from. until the display shows hS SeTTingS and until ringer is displayed, press until ring VOlUMe is displayed, press You can also turn the handset ringer off by pressing and holding the button. 3. The current ringtone is played at the current volume setting. or to listen to new volume levels or off, press Press to store. Press and hold to return to standby. If you experience any problems, please call the Helpline on Freephone 0800 218 2182* or email bt. helpdesk@vtecheurope. com 24 Handset tones on/off Your BT Studio Plus 5100 has a series of tones designed to alert you to certain situations. A tone will sound: when the battery is low; when you move out of range of the base and there is no coverage; to confirm each button press (key beeps). You can switch the handset tones on or off. until the display shows hS SeTTingS and until TOneS is displayed, press to select. to select the tone you want: KeY BeePS, BaTTerY lOW or OUT OF range and press to select. 5.
